What are we given in the CT3 Exam

Can someone please confirm exactly what we are given in the exam.

I assume we can have
-ruler
-calculator (one that is approved)
-Orange book "Formulae and Tables for Examination"

Is that it? Are we given any other formulas or do we need to remember all of the other ones?!!

Thanks
 
You are supplied with:
- the exam paper and answer booklet (obviously!)
- graph paper if the exam requires it (if this is the case it should say on the front of the exam paper)
- a copy of "Formulae and Tables for Examination"
- some scrap paper for rough workings (this is not submitted at the end of the exam so make sure to provide all relevant workings in the answer booklet)
- continuation paper is supplied on request if you run out of space in the answer booklet

You have to memorise anything not in the formula book.

You have to provide your own calculators, pens, ruler etc.

Hope that helps.

about the scrap paper - it varies by exam centre whether they give you it or not. Some don't automatically but you can ask. failing that don't be afraid to write on the exam paper if necessary.

On the topic of graphs, be careful. Strict exam rules say pencil is not allowed.
 
I had a look at the instructions on the answer booklet in my exam this week and they state that scrap paper is provided (which indeed it was). Therefore I think that all exam centres really ought to be supplying the scrap paper automatically rather than just on request.
